Inverse Fuzzy Graphs with Applications

New Mathematics and Natural Computation, 2020
Rosenfeld [A. Rosenfeld, Fuzzy Graphs, Fuzzy Sets and Their Applications, eds. L. A. Zadeh, K. S. Fu and M. Shimura (Academic Press, New York, 1975), pp. 77–95.] defined the fuzzy relations on the fuzzy sets and developed the structure of fuzzy graph, as a graph with a membership degree (between zero and one) for the vertices and edges such that the ...

Fuzzy mason graphs

Fuzzy Sets and Systems, 1992
The extension of a well-known class of Mason graphs (linear flow graphs) deals with their generalization through fuzzy variables. The \(k\)th node of the graph is described in the form, \(\widetilde\Sigma_ j X_ j\otimes T_{jk}= X_ k\), \(k=12,\dots,N\).

FUZZY GRAPH STRUCTURE OF FLOWER GRAPHS

Far East Journal of Applied Mathematics, 2017
Summary: In this paper, we consider a flower graph \(fl_n\) and define the membership function for vertices and edges for \(fl_n\) to make it a fuzzy flower graph \(f\widetilde{l}_n\). Then the fuzzy graph structure for \(f\widetilde{l}_n\) is developed. The vertex and edge cohesive number of \(f\widetilde{l}_n\) are computed.

Generalized fuzzy Euler graphs and generalized fuzzy Hamiltonian graphs

Journal of Intelligent & Fuzzy Systems, 2018
Graph theory includes two unavoidable graphs, namely Euler graphs and Hamiltonian graphs. In this study, generalized fuzzy Euler graphs (GFEGs) and generalized fuzzy Hamiltonian graphs (GFHGs) are defined to express uncertain system like routes, networks. Here, even degrees of all vertices of graphs do not assure that the graphs are GFEG.
